S30615 Stainless Steel vs. SAE-AISI A3 Steel

Both S30615 stainless steel and SAE-AISI A3 steel are iron alloys. They have 67%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 22 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(12,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S30615 stainless steel and the bottom bar is SAE-AISI A3 steel.
